Engineering Applications Software Engineer

NASA Jet Propulsion Laboratory · Pasadena, CA · 5 days ago
Analyst$93k–$111k/yrFull-time

Responsibilities

  • Provide software development, operational, and customer support for flight mission and R&D projects utilizing DOM and LSMD systems.
  • Collaborate with project task leads to design, develop, maintain, and operate data management, GenAI, and data visualization software systems on on-prem and cloud compute/storage platforms.
  • Design and develop 2D/3D data visualization software, dashboard tools, and UI/UX interfaces to support ground and flight systems.
  • Design, develop, and deploy web and cloud-centric software applications across the entire flight mission life-cycle—from initial formulation through Assembly, Test, and Launch Operations (ATLO) within operational venues at JPL and other NASA centers.
  • Design and develop software solutions to process and serve real-time mission telemetry data from multiple simultaneous sources to multi-mission analysis tools.
  • Architect and develop AWS GenAI pipelines optimized for the analysis and visualization of exceptionally large flight mission telemetry datasets.
  • Generate and deliver comprehensive software documentation, including requirements, design documents, and standard operational procedures.
  • Maintain a working knowledge of applicable Laboratory policies, NASA procedures, and government regulations.

Qualifications

  • Typically requires a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Mathematics, or a related discipline with a minimum of 1 year of related experience, or a Master’s degree in a similar discipline with 0 years of related experience.
  • Security Clearance: Willingness to complete NASA’s required Level of Confidence background check for physical and logical access to critical NASA assets.
  • Core Technical Proficiency: Strong proficiency in C, C++, Python, JavaScript, TypeScript, WebGL, React, MaterialUI, Angular, and AWS Cloud computing/storage platforms.
  • GenAI Expertise: Demonstrated experience developing GenAI pipelines on-prem and in AWS using tools such as Parquet, Athena, Claude, and Bedrock.
  • Software Practices: Knowledge of modern software development infrastructure (GitHub, Visual Studio Code, CI/CD pipelines, automated software testing, and Agile methodologies).
  • Mathematics & Analytics: Excellent applied math skills, including Calculus and Linear Algebra, alongside knowledge of modern data science and ML/LLM techniques.
  • Data Management: Understanding of modern Information Data Management tools, architectures, and best practices (relational and time-series database solutions).
  • UI/UX Design: Experience designing and developing user-facing web and desktop UI/UX software.
  • Problem Solving & Debugging: Exceptional software engineering, algorithm development, system debugging, and technical problem-solving skills in complex environments.
  • Teamwork & Communication: Strong interpersonal, oral, and written communication skills with a proven commitment to customer satisfaction and broad-based teamwork.
  • Prioritization: Ability to establish clear task priorities and manage evolving requirements as flight project data management needs change.
